The Technology Behind Mine Detection

Mine detection has traditionally posed significant challenges due to the complex environments where mines are typically found. The introduction of deep learning and advanced imaging techniques has transformed this field, particularly with the application of the YOLOv11 algorithm. This model leverages RGB imagery to identify mines in real-time, making it a game-changer for safety operations in various sectors.

Binghamton University's recent evaluation of this technology highlights how deep learning models can analyze visual data faster and with greater precision than previous methods. The YOLOv11 algorithm stands out for its ability to process RGB images quickly, allowing for quicker responses in mine detection.

Challenges and Future Directions

Despite the promising developments in deep learning and RGB imaging, challenges remain. Variations in terrain, lighting conditions, and the presence of debris can affect detection accuracy. Continuous research and field-testing are essential to refine these algorithms further and adapt them to different environmental conditions.

Next Steps in Research

Future research should focus on integrating other imaging modalities, such as thermal or multispectral imaging, alongside RGB technology. Doing so could enhance detection rates in complex environments. Moreover, collaboration among universities, tech companies, and international organizations could expedite the deployment of these technologies in affected areas.
